The president of Romania Klaus Iohannis had a meeting in Athens on Friday with his Greek counterpart, Katerina Sakellaropoulou, who reiterated Greece’s full support for Romania’s Schengen accession. The two officials praised the very good relations between the two countries, strengthened by cultural affinities and by a long common history, and emphasized the close cooperation at EU, regional and international level. Given the current security situation generated by Russia’s illegal military aggression against Ukraine, they emphasized the importance of maintaining trans-Atlantic unity and solidarity and reiterated the support that their respective countries will continue to give to Ukraine and to Ukrainian refugees, as well as to the R. of Moldova. The Romanian president is in Greece for a 2-day official visit.
